The Family Tree is a community tree made up of contributions from researchers over many years. Start by adding information about yourself, your parents, and so on, back as far as you have information. As you get to deceased persons in your tree, the system will begin searching for matches. The Portrait view is available in Family Tree on the FamilySearch.org website and in the Family Tree mobile app. It is not available in Family Tree Lite. Advantages: You can see many generations of a family at one time. You can follow one family line back or forward in time. You can see record hints, research suggestions, and data problems.

FamilySearch Family Tree FamilySearch FamilyTree (FSFT) is a "one world tree," or a unified database that aims to contain one entry for each person recorded in genealogical records. All FamilySearch users are able to add persons, link them to existing persons or merge duplicates. insta360 app Creating your own family tree on FamilySearch.org is super easy. Birth, death, and marriage records. Census Records.Today, the Family Tree has well over a billion names and nearly 20 million photos. How to Use the FamilySearch Family Tree. The FamilySearch tree differs fundamentally from other large online family trees, such as those on Ancestry.com and MyHeritage. The Family­Search Family Tree consists not of individually owned trees, but of a single tree ...
